    Abstract: A stereoscopic image display device is for use with shutter glasses having left and right shutter lenses and includes a display processor, a display screen, a signal generator, and a signal transmitter. The display processor is for receiving a video input signal and outputting a video output signal sequence according to a frame sync signal acquired from the video input signal. The display screen is for receiving the video output signal sequence corresponding to a sequence of left-eye and right-eye images and displays the left-eye and right-eye images in an alternating manner according to the frame sync signal. The signal generator is for generating a shutter sync control signal that is transmitted to the shutter glasses by the signal transmitter for controlling duty cycles of alternating operations of the shutter glasses according to the frame sync signal.

    Abstract: A linear actuator includes two spaced seats connecting by a center piezoelectric member. The seats are mounted in a rail frame. Each seat has a piezoelectric member and an elastic zone for engaging or disengaging with the rail frame. Through energizing and disenergizing the center piezoelectric member alternately, the center piezoelectric member may be extended or contracted alternately, and thus moves the seats, consequently the actuator, longitudinally along the rail frame. A linear and accurate movement of the actuator thus may be achieved at micro meter level.
